TSA Begins REAL ID Enforcement on May 7
Avoid delays when flying private: Make sure you're REAL ID ready before the May 7, 2025, enforcement deadline in the U.S. Anyone 18 years and older who plans to fly domestically will need a REAL ID card or another acceptable form of identification like a U.S. passport at TSA security checkpoints.
